All too often undergraduate readers find themselves overwhelmed by textbooks on the history of American foreign relations - the scholarly tone leaving them frustrated, the onslaught of names, events, policies, and counter-policies leaving them unable to realise important continuities in a multidimensional story.

It is with the student reader in mind that this second edition offers a concise narrative history that in straight-forward language relates the long and complex history of the relationships between the United States and the nations of Latin America.

Like its predecessor, this new edition is ideal for use as a core text for courses in American Foreign Relations and makes engaging supplementary reading for survey courses in U.S. as well as Latin American History.
